Sha256: 2ddc684da08ba6de0f27ad45647fe3928a59c79dd4d310a38fd4485f58104d74

Contents?: true

Size: 337 Bytes

Versions: 182

Compression:

Stored size: 337 Bytes

Contents

# frozen_string_literal: true

module PgEngine
  module PostgresHelper
    # Le pone la timezone
    def add_timezone(field)
      "#{field}::TIMESTAMPTZ AT TIME ZONE INTERVAL '-03:00'::INTERVAL"
    end

    # Le pone la timezone y lo convierte a Date
    def get_date_tz(field)
      "(#{add_timezone(field)})::date"
    end
  end
end

Version data entries

182 entries across 182 versions & 1 rubygems

Version Path
pg_rails-7.6.35 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.34 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.33 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.32 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.31 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.30 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.29 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.28 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.27 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.26 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.25 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.24 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.24.pre.5 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.24.pre.4 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.24.pre.3 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.23 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.22 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.22.pre.3 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.22.pre.2 pg_engine/app/helpers/pg_engine/postgres_helper.rb
pg_rails-7.6.22.pre.1 pg_engine/app/helpers/pg_engine/postgres_helper.rb